面向对象语言的AOP扩展  

AOP Extension of Object-Oriented Language

在线阅读下载全文

作  者:张海峰[1] 

机构地区:[1]嘉应学院计算机科学与技术系,广东梅州514015

出  处:《嘉应学院学报》2006年第6期97-101,共5页Journal of Jiaying University

摘  要:随着AOP日益广泛的应用,几乎所有的OO语言都进行了面向方面的扩展,然而这些语言无法实现对非正交方面的有效表达,方面调节模式通过一组类实现了联结器的基本任务,在该编程模式下能使用通用OO语言支持AOP,同时它的分层应用模式支持更大粒度的方面描述,能作为各种轻量级AOSD框架的基础,其简洁性和扩充性也能适应面向对象软件的方面挖掘工程的需要。Along with the wider application of AOP, almost all OO languages have extended themselves in aspect - oriented, but this can not realize effective expression on non - orthogonal aspect. Aspect moderate model has achieved the basic task of weaver by a group of classes. It could use common OO languages to support AOP under such programming model, meanwhile its layered application mode could support aspect description on a greater large - scale. As a variety of basic of lightweight AOSD framework, its simplicity and extensibility can also adapt to the demand of the aspect mining work of the object - oriented software.

关 键 词:面向方面 AOP 面向对象 JAVA 

分 类 号:TP312[自动化与计算机技术—计算机软件与理论]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象